首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

dedecms 整站

DedeCMS(织梦内容管理系统)是一款基于PHP+MySQL开发的开源网站管理系统,它提供了丰富的功能和灵活的扩展性,适用于各种类型的网站构建。

基础概念

DedeCMS采用MVC架构,主要分为三部分:模型(Model)、视图(View)和控制器(Controller)。它提供了文章管理、会员管理、模板管理、数据库备份与恢复等功能。

优势

  1. 开源免费:DedeCMS是开源软件,用户可以自由下载和使用。
  2. 功能丰富:内置了文章管理、会员管理、广告管理等多种功能。
  3. 模板丰富:提供了大量的免费和付费模板,用户可以根据需要选择合适的模板。
  4. 扩展性强:支持插件和扩展,用户可以根据需求进行二次开发。
  5. 社区支持:有活跃的社区支持,用户可以获取大量的帮助和资源。

类型

DedeCMS主要分为以下几种类型:

  1. 新闻网站:适用于新闻发布和管理的网站。
  2. 企业网站:适用于企业宣传和信息展示的网站。
  3. 个人博客:适用于个人分享和记录生活的博客。
  4. 电商网站:通过插件可以扩展为电商网站。

应用场景

DedeCMS广泛应用于各种类型的网站,包括但不限于:

  • 新闻资讯网站
  • 企业官网
  • 个人博客
  • 教育培训网站
  • 旅游景点介绍网站

常见问题及解决方法

问题1:DedeCMS后台登录失败

原因:可能是数据库连接错误、用户名密码错误或者服务器配置问题。 解决方法

  1. 检查数据库连接配置文件(如config.php),确保数据库地址、用户名、密码等信息正确。
  2. 确认用户名和密码是否正确。
  3. 检查服务器配置,确保PHP和MySQL服务正常运行。

问题2:DedeCMS文章无法发布

原因:可能是权限问题、数据库问题或者模板问题。 解决方法

  1. 检查当前用户是否有发布文章的权限。
  2. 检查数据库,确保文章表没有损坏。
  3. 检查模板文件,确保模板中没有阻止文章发布的代码。

问题3:DedeCMS网站访问速度慢

原因:可能是服务器性能问题、数据库查询效率低或者网站代码优化不足。 解决方法

  1. 升级服务器配置,提高服务器性能。
  2. 优化数据库查询,使用索引和缓存技术。
  3. 优化网站代码,减少不必要的计算和资源消耗。

示例代码

以下是一个简单的DedeCMS文章发布示例:

代码语言:txt
复制
<?php
require_once('include/common.inc.php');
$dsql = new DedeSql(false);
$dsql->SetQuery("INSERT INTO `dede_archives` (typeid, title, writer, pubdate, sortrank, flag) VALUES (1, '示例文章', '管理员', NOW(), 10, 'h') ");
$dsql->ExecuteNoneQuery();
?>

参考链接

通过以上信息,您可以更好地了解DedeCMS的基础概念、优势、类型、应用场景以及常见问题的解决方法。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券